The University of Iowa Athletics Department announced that season tickets for the 2025-26 women’s basketball season have sold out, marking the third consecutive year of sellouts. The department stated that more information about student ticket programs and limited single-game ticket availability will be provided at a later date.
Iowa’s women’s basketball team currently holds the nation’s longest active streak with 35 consecutive home sellouts. The program has also ranked in the top 10 nationally for attendance over each of the past six seasons.
For the upcoming season, Iowa welcomes five new players: three freshmen—Addie Deal, Layla Hays, and Journey Houston—and two sophomore transfers, Emely Rodriguez and Chit-Chat Wright.
Fans are invited to attend “Hawkeye Hoops from Downtown presented by HyVee” on Friday, October 17. The event will take place at the outdoor basketball court behind Burge Residence Hall starting at 5:30 p.m. Central Time. Attendees will get their first look at both the men’s and women’s teams ahead of the new season.
Last year, Iowa achieved two victories in the Big Ten Tournament and won its NCAA Tournament first-round game against Murray State. The Hawkeyes also reached their ninth straight 20-win season—the second-longest such streak in program history. Jan Jensen, in her first year as head coach, recorded the second-most wins by a first-year head coach in program history.
